This contract pertains to the natural gas utility requirements for the fourth quarter at USP Hazelton, a federal prison facility located in Bruceton Mills, West Virginia. The contract is issued by the Federal Prison System under the Department of Justice and is categorized under NAICS code 221210, which involves natural gas distribution. It is identified as a forecast opportunity, indicating anticipated procurement rather than an active solicitation, and does not specify a set-aside type beyond a generic "Other" classification. Key points include the involvement of the Bureau of Prisons as the contracting agency and designated points of contact for inquiries: Justin Wray and a Small Business Program representative. The contract supports the ongoing operational needs of USP Hazelton by securing the natural gas utilities required for its facility, ensuring energy supply essential for institutional functions. The official contract opportunity and additional details are made accessible through the Department of Justice’s contracting forecast portal.

Natural Gas Supply 2026The U.S. Department of Defense, through the 910th Airlift Wing at Youngstown War Memorial Airport in Vienna, Ohio, is reopening Solicitation FA665626Q0009 for the supply of natural gas under a firm-fixed-price contract with economic price adjustment, following the failure to receive any responsible quotes by the original deadline. This combined notice/solicitation, issued under RFO Part 12, seeks one-year natural gas delivery services totaling approximately 55,000 MCF annually, with pricing required in MCF unit rates and supplies must be of domestic origin. All offers must be valid for 15 days and submitted by the new deadline of August 10, 2026, at 10:00 AM EST. Payment will be processed exclusively through Enbridge Ohio Gas using account number 5500019027512, and individual invoicing is not permitted. The contract will be awarded to the lowest-priced, technically acceptable offer that meets all mandatory criteria. Offerors must be certified by the Public Utilities Commission of Ohio (PUCO) for natural gas generation, maintain active and accurate registration in the System for Award Management (SAM), and ensure all representations and certifications are fully completed in SAM. The NAICS code is 221210 with a small business size standard of 1,000 employees, and the solicitation is fully open with no set-aside. The acquisition incorporates a comprehensive set of Revolutionary FAR Overhaul (RFO) and R-DFARS provisions and clauses governing ethical conduct, cybersecurity, domestic sourcing, labor practices, subcontracting, and compliance with federal regulations, including prohibitions on procurement from the Xinjiang region or the Maduro regime. Offerors must include their UEI and CAGE code, and failure to meet any of the four unique requirements will result in disqualification. Funding is not currently available, and no obligation to award a contract or reimburse proposal costs is implied.
